½ Penny - George III (Pattern)
Country: United Kingdom
Denomination: 1/2 Penny
(1/480)
Year: 1799
Material: Copper
Weight: 14.431 g
Shape: Round
Diameter:
Type: Pattern
Catalog list: united kingdom
Description:
Obverse
Draped bust of George wearing large crown facing right
Reverse
Britannia, draped, seated on rock facing left holding trident and exrending an olive branch; resting at right, oval shield bearing the crosses of St. George ans St. Andrew; in background at left a three masted sailing ship
